| contents | A previous paper by the authors found explicit contour integral formulas for certain joint moments of the multi-species q-TAZRP (totally asymmetric zero range process), using algebraic methods. These contour integral formulas have a "pseudo-factorized" form which makes asymptotic analysis simpler. In this brief note, we use those contour integral formulas to find the asymptotics of the two-point correlations. As expected, the term arising from the "shift-invariance" makes a non-trivial asymptotic contribution. |
